Symphony No. 3 is the third symphony by Austrian composer Gustav Mahler, completed in 1896. A large-scale late-Romantic work notable for its vast orchestral forces, incorporation of vocal elements and wide-ranging tonal and thematic contrasts, it marks a pivotal point in Mahler's output and in the evolution of symphonic writing at the turn of the century.
